Yeah, there is a huge difference in powerful shooting from 18" where the opponent have a chance to counter charge you (expecially with the double turn), and powerful shooting from 24+" where few units can get the ranged unit into combat in one round or even with a double turn. So the ideal shooting for me would be low damage from long distance and powerful shooting where you put your ranged unit in a possibly dangerous situation. However, it is not only shooting that is the problem but also other MW damage from magic etc. that hits very uneven where some armies have could protection and other have extremly little.

  10. Considering all the teleports in a lot of armies it could be an idea to put the fanatics in the shootas so if someone try to teleport in something to kill your shootas they get a nasty suprise. I think everybody will expect you to put the fanatics in the stabbas so by doing so you might do a lot of havoc in their plans. As for a blob of 60 or 40 it could be good to have another hero to be able to give away battleshock immunity and buff either the boingrots or the stabbas, so a Loonboss an Great Cave Squig could be good. The advantage with boingrots is that they can give MW, so I would probably go with them instead of Troggoth. You will also probably have more bodies on the objectives with boingrots.
